Ricky Gervais
Ricky Dene Gervais (born 25 June 1961) is an English stand-up comedian, actor, writer, film producer, director and musician. He is perhaps best known for creating, writing and acting in the British television series The Office (2001–2003). He has won seven BAFTA Awards, five British Comedy Awards, two Emmy Awards, three Golden Globe Awards and the Rose d'Or twice (2006 and 2019), as well as a Screen Actors Guild Award nomination. In 2007, he was placed at No. 11 on Channel 4's 100 Greatest Stand-Ups and at No. 3 on the updated 2010 list. In 2010, he was named on the Time 100 list of the world's most influential people.

Ricky Gervais launches new podcast ‘Absolutely Mental’

Ricky Gervais has announced that he will host a new paid-for podcast called Absolutely Mental.The 11-part podcast will be available on AbsolutelyMental.com from May 10, and will feature the comedian in conversation with his friend, neuroscientist Sam Harris.“These aren’t academic lectures.

They are casual chats about how it feels to be human,” Gervais told Deadline. He also confirmed that topics discussed between the pair will range from dreams, free will and death, to the robot apocalypse and the future of comedy.

The series will be available in its entirety on the launch date, and will cost $14.99.Gervais has been a major name in podcasting since the launch of The Ricky Gervais Show in 2005.
